Textron Aviation has completed a successful first flight of its new twin utility turboprop, the Cessna SkyCourier. The milestone flight is a significant step toward entry into service for the clean-sheet aircraft, and it kicks off the important flight test programme that validates the performance of the SkyCourier.

The Cessna SkyCourier took off from the company's east campus Beech Field airport, piloted by Corey Eckhart, senior test pilot, and Aaron Tobias, chief test pilot. During the two hour and 15 minute flight, the team tested the aircraft's performance, stability and control, as well as its propulsion, environmental, flight controls and avionics systems.

The prototype aircraft, along with five additional flight and ground test articles, will continue to expand on performance goals, focusing on testing flight controls and aerodynamics.

The Cessna SkyCourier, featuring Pratt & Whitney Canada PT6A-65SC engines, will be offered in various configurations including a 6,000-pound payload capable freighter, a 19-seat passenger version or a mixed passenger/freight combination, all based on the common platform.

The aircraft is designed for high utilisation, and will deliver a combination of robust performance and lower operating costs. The Cessna SkyCourier will feature the popular Garmin G1000 NXi avionics suite and offer highlights such as a maximum cruise speed of up to 200 ktas and a maximum range of 900 nm. Both freighter and passenger variants of the SkyCourier will include single-point pressure refuelling as standard to enable faster turnarounds.
